Maishofen, Salzburg, Austria

Overview

Maishofen is a charming Austrian village set in the scenic Salzach valley, surrounded by the towering peaks of the Alps. Known for its peaceful atmosphere, friendly locals, and proximity to Zell am See, it offers a blend of rural traditions and easy access to outdoor adventures year-round.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for outdoor hiking and lake activities, or December-March for winter sports nearby.

Local Tips

Consider renting a bike to explore the extensive cycling paths, and check if local festivals are happening at the center plaza for an authentic experience.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is customary (around 5-10%); dress comfortably yet modestly in public spaces; always greet locals politely with 'Grüß Gott'.

Safety Warnings

Maishofen is very safe, but exercise standard caution when hiking or cycling; roads can be busy during peak tourist season.

Hidden Gems

Visit Schloss Saalhof for quiet gardens, or find the scenic Tauern cycling trail starting in Maishofen for an off-the-beaten-path adventure.
